titleOfInvention | A kind of laser mosquito eradication fly instrument |
abstract | A kind of laser mosquito eradication fly instrument, comprise support, transmitting dish, reflecting disc and control system, described control system, its input is connected with miniature laser receiver, its output is connected with miniature laser transmitter, and control system is by receiving the signal of miniature laser receiver to adjust the power of miniature laser transmitter Emission Lasers with sand mosquitos and flies.Laser mosquito eradication fly instrument of the present utility model is for existing kill mosquitoes and the method for fly and the behaviour in service of instrument and equipment and shortcoming, based on Laser emission and reception technique and DSP digital control technology, a kind of laser mosquito eradication fly instrument is proposed, avoid existing going out except the intrinsic shortcoming and defect of the method and apparatus of mosquitos and flies, indoor can be realized and go out except the automation of mosquitos and flies, intellectuality. |
